Basic Information
CGSNL Gene Symbol OSK1
Gene Symbol Synonym osk1, SnRK1A, OsSnRK1A, OsSNRK1a, SnRK1A/OSK1, SnRK1a, OsSnRK1.2, SnRK1.2, OsSnRK1alphaA, SnRK1alphaA
CGSNL Gene Name PROTEIN KINASE 1
Gene Name Synonym protein kinase 1, SnRK1A protein kinase, sucrose non-fermenting-1 related protein kinase 1a, SNF1-Related Protein Kinase 1A
Protein Name PROTEIN KINASE 1
Allele snrk1a, snrk1a-1, snrk1a-2, snrk1alphaa, ossnrk1a, ossnrk1a-1, ossnrk1a-2, ossnrk1a-3, snrk1a-c, snrk1a-c2, snrk1a-c3
Chromosome No. 5
Explanation D82039. AB101655. GO:0080151: positive regulation of salicylic acid mediated signaling pathway. GO:1900426: positive regulation of defense response to bacterium. GO:0097009: energy homeostasis. GO:0090549: response to carbon starvation. PO:0030123: panicle inflorescence. GO:0090693: plant organ senescence. TO:0001041: root yield. GO:2000280: regulation of root development. GO:0140426: PAMP-triggered immunity signalling pathway. TO:0000949: seedling growth and development trait.
